Set one hundred years into the future (2063) XL5 patrolled and protected sector 25 of the solar system on behalf of World Space Patrol, run by Commander (Wilbur) Zero, who was based at WSP headquarters on Earth's Space City.

Frequently Asked Questions  Warning: Spoilers

When did 'Fireball XL5' first premiere?

'Fireball XL5' first premiered on October 28, 1962.

Who plays the character of Steve Zodiac in 'Fireball XL5'?

The character of Steve Zodiac is voiced by Paul Maxwell in 'Fireball XL5'.

What is the main premise of 'Fireball XL5'?

'Fireball XL5' follows the adventures of the crew of spaceship Fireball XL5 as they travel through space on various missions.

Who created 'Fireball XL5'?

'Fireball XL5' was created by Gerry and Sylvia Anderson.

What are the names of the main characters in 'Fireball XL5'?

The main characters in 'Fireball XL5' are Steve Zodiac, Venus, Professor Matic, and Robert the Robot.

What is the name of Steve Zodiac's ship in 'Fireball XL5'?

Steve Zodiac's ship in 'Fireball XL5' is called Fireball XL5.

Who is the main villain in 'Fireball XL5'?

The main villain in 'Fireball XL5' is a character called the Hood.

What type of animation was used in 'Fireball XL5'?

'Fireball XL5' was produced using marionette puppetry.

What is the name of the robotic co-pilot on Fireball XL5 in 'Fireball XL5'?

The robotic co-pilot on Fireball XL5 in 'Fireball XL5' is named Robert the Robot.

How many episodes of 'Fireball XL5' were produced?

A total of 39 episodes of 'Fireball XL5' were produced.

Who was responsible for creating the special effects in 'Fireball XL5'?

Derek Meddings was responsible for creating the special effects in 'Fireball XL5'.

Who composed the music for 'Fireball XL5'?

The music for 'Fireball XL5' was composed by Barry Gray.
